Stephanie Renee
Music has been a part of Stephanie Renee's life from the very beginning. She often says she started singing before she could even talk. Raised in a Southern family where music was woven into everyday life, Stephanie grew up surrounded by musicians and found her voice singing in church from an early age.
By the age of 13, Stephanie was already performing professionally. As a child, she appeared on Star Search, and at just 16 years old she competed on American Idol, advancing past more than 24,000 hopefuls and coming within one step of earning a coveted Golden Ticket. Those early experiences helped shape the performer she is today and fueled a lifelong passion for entertaining audiences.
Throughout her career, Stephanie has shared the stage with an impressive list of nationally recognized artists, including Joe Diffie, Patty Loveless, Jeff Bates, Foreigner, Loverboy, Steve Holy, and Joe Nichols, among many others. She has also been featured on multiple radio stations and television morning shows, giving her the opportunity to share her music with an even wider audience.
